2
respostas

Atividade "Comparação estranha"

Na linha do if, ele deveria ter usado "==" em vez do "="

2 respostas

Olá Sérgio! Tudo certinho?

Isso aí! Mandou bem =)

A utilização de apenas um "=" funciona para atribuição de um valor em uma variável, quando desejamos comparar dois valores ou variáveis utilizamos o "=="

Bons estudos e qualquer dúvida é só passar aqui no fórum!

Olá, Sérgio! Aqui está algumas demonstração de exemplos de operadores: Espero ter ajudado!

Menor que, a < b;

>>> 1 < 2
True
Menor ou igual a, a <= b;

>>> 1 <= 2
True
Maior que, a > b;

>>> 1 > 2
False
Maior ou igual a, a >= b;

>>> 1 >= 2
False
Entre, não inclusivo, a < v < b;

>>> v = 5
>>> 1 < v < 9
True
Entre, inclusivo, a <= v <= b;

>>> v = 5
>>> 1 <= v <= 9
True
Igualdade, a == b;

>>> 1 == 2
False
Diferença, a != b;

>>> 1 != 2
True
Diferença, a <> b (obsoleto a partir da versão 2.5, removido nas versões 3+);

>>> 1 <> 2
True